Small-town staple
Little Italy Pizza
The Plains • Classic Neighborhood Carryout • Go-To For Locals
The Plains’ own Little Italy serves no-frills, satisfying pies that locals rely on for weeknight dinners and game-day takeout.
This small shop on South Plains Road is the kind of place where people know their usual order by heart. Expect thick layers of cheese, well-seasoned sauce, and generous toppings on sturdy crusts built to travel. It is especially handy when you want a hot pizza without driving into Athens.

Most creative pies
Avalanche Pizza
East Athens • Artisan Pizzeria And Slice House • Best For Adventurous Toppings
Avalanche turns out inventive, boldly topped pies that feel more like chef-driven specials than standard college-town pizza.
A short drive from The Plains, Avalanche is where Athens locals send anyone looking for something beyond pepperoni and mushrooms. The menu leans into creative combinations, with toppings like house-made sausages, roasted vegetables, and specialty cheeses on a chewy, flavorful crust. It is a strong pick when you want to impress visiting friends or split a few specialty pies at a table.

Late-night classic
Goodfella's Pizza
Court Street, Athens • Lively Campus Slice Shop • Late-Night Slice Standby
Goodfella’s is the Court Street institution for oversized, foldable slices that hit the spot after a night out in Athens.
This downtown counter-service spot is all about speed, slices, and people-watching. Pies are baked large with a thinner crust, plenty of cheese, and crowd-pleasing toppings, then sold by the slice until the early hours. It is not fancy, but if you are in town for a game or concert, grabbing a slice here is part of the Athens experience.

Best for big orders
Donatos Pizza
East State Street, Athens • Thin-Crust Regional Chain • Top Pick For Sharing
Donatos is known for edge-to-edge toppings on a crisp thin crust, making it a reliable choice when you are feeding a crowd.
Located along the main commercial strip in Athens, Donatos is easy to reach from The Plains and set up for fast carryout or delivery. Pizzas come cut into squares with a layer of toppings that stretches right to the rim, so every piece feels loaded. It is especially useful for team dinners, watch parties, or any night when you need several predictable, crowd-pleasing pies.

Family-friendly choice
Pizza Cottage
East State Street, Athens • Casual Dine-In Pizzeria • Family Dinner Favorite
Pizza Cottage pairs hearty, topping-heavy pies with a relaxed dining room that works well for families and groups.
A short hop from The Plains, this regional chain offers roomy booths, plenty of TVs, and a menu that stretches from pizzas to appetizers and salads. The crust is slightly thicker, with a soft bite that holds plenty of cheese and toppings. It is a comfortable option when you want to sit down, let the kids spread out, and linger over a couple of pizzas and a shared basket of sides.
